The rapid evolution of the Internet of Things (IoT) has remodeled how devices connect and communicate with each other. As more IoT devices turn into commonplace, understanding the key components to contemplate for IoT system connectivity has turn out to be essential for designers, developers, and companies looking to leverage these technologies.


One essential issue is the selection of communication protocols. Various protocols such as MQTT, CoAP, Bluetooth, and Zigbee serve distinct purposes and environments. The suitability of a protocol typically is decided by particular necessities like information transfer velocity, energy consumption, and the range needed.

Power consumption is one other important factor. Many IoT units are battery-operated and should, due to this fact, prioritize energy efficiency. Protocols that enable low-power operation or sleep modes can considerably prolong the lifespan of a device, which is important for feasibility in remote or hard-to-service locations.


Security is paramount in IoT connectivity. With a rise in knowledge breaches and cyber threats, securing connections and information must be prioritized. Implementing encryption standards, secure authentication methods, and regular updates will assist safeguard against unauthorized access and ensure the integrity of knowledge exchanged amongst units.

    What are the first connectivity options for IoT devices?





The primary connectivity choices for IoT units embrace Wi-Fi, Bluetooth, cellular networks (4G/5G), LoRaWAN, Zigbee, and NB-IoT. Global Nb-Iot Sim Card. Choosing the right option is decided by factors like range, power consumption, data rate, and community infrastructure.

What should I consider regarding knowledge transmission rates for IoT devices?


Data transmission charges should align with the application’s requirements. For example, real-time functions like video streaming need greater information charges, whereas sensor information that updates periodically can operate nicely with lower rates. Choosing a expertise that matches these needs is significant.

What are the challenges of connecting IoT gadgets in remote areas?


Connecting IoT devices in distant areas usually presents challenges such as limited network infrastructure, unstable connectivity, and high latency. Solutions like satellite tv for pc communication or long-range, low-power networks might help mitigate these points and enhance connectivity.


Can I integrate numerous connectivity choices within a single IoT ecosystem?


Yes, integrating numerous connectivity choices is feasible and infrequently helpful. Multi-technology approaches can improve flexibility, permitting devices to change between networks based on availability, energy, and power requirements, guaranteeing more reliable system performance.
